Johnson holds off Chestatee to remain unbeaten

By staff reports
Posted 10:50PM on Friday 7th December 2012 ( 11 years ago )
GAINESVILLE -- Johnson built a big first half lead and then held on to beat Chestatee 96-83 Friday night in boys basketball action.

The Knights (7-0) jumped out to a 25-15 lead after the first quarter and extended their lead to 50-30 by halftime. Chestatee, however, would get back in the game in the second half behind solid shotting.

The War Eagles drained eight of their 12 3-pointers after halftime. They outscored Johnson 28-24 in the third quarter, and would eventually cut the lead to 11 midway through the fourth quarter.

But Johnson answered each Chestatee run to hold on down the stretch.

Johnson was led by Ty Cockfield with 31 points and seven rebounds. Montrell McKenzie had 19 points and 10 rebounds while James Hodges and Carter Cagle each added 13 points for the Knights. Roderick English had 11 points and Drew Dunham fell one point shy of a triple-double, with 9 points, 12 assists, and 10 rebounds for Johnson.

Chestatee was led by Keelan Passmore with 18 points and Jordan Stubblefield with 16.

Johnson next will take on arch-rival West Hall Saturday on the road. Chestatee will play host to Forsyth Central on Saturday.
